- 浏览: 200541 次
- 性别:
- 来自: 北京
最新评论
-
shijingjing07:
好文!必须得顶
解析JavaScript中的null和undefined -
bryan.liu:
非常清晰易懂的解释了浦东Web Service 和RESTfu ...
解析Restful Web Service -
yyang1986321:
lucene的hit类 -
lshmouse:
今年百度之星复赛的第一题就是这个问题,不过限定内存1M
大数据量的查询词缓存 -
wangichao:
看过了 不错!但不是自己想要的哦!
现在的也在搞数据库的架构 ...
大数据量的查询词缓存
文章列表
TRUNCATE TABLE 和不带 WHERE 的 DELETE 功能是一样的,都是删除表中的所有数据,不过 TRUNCATE TABLE 速度更快,占用的日志更少,这是因为 TRUNCATE TABLE 直接释放数据页并且在事务日志中也只记录数据页的释放,而 DELETE 是一行一行地删除,在事务日志中要记录每一条记录的删除。那么可不可以用 TRUNCATE TABLE 代替不带 WHERE 的 DELETE 呢?在以下情况是不行的: 1、要保留标识的情况下不能用 TRUNCATE TABLE,因为 TRUNCATE TABLE 会重置标识。 2、需要使用触发器的情况下不能使用 TRUNCA ...
- 2009-09-10 21:52
- 浏览 1236
- 评论(0)
计算诸如平均值和总和的函数被称为聚集函数(Aggregate Functions )。当使用聚集函数时,SQLServer对整个表或表里某个组中的字段进行汇总、计算,然后为它创建相应字段的单个的值。
可以在SELECT语句中单独使用聚集函数,也可以 ...
- 2009-09-10 20:41
- 浏览 1629
- 评论(0)
如何复制其它表的结构到一指定的表中去,比如以下的例子:
有如下三个表:
表A:字段1, 字段2, 字段3
表B:字段1, 字段2, 字段3
表C:字段1, 字段2, 字段3
现在想复制A表的字段1,B表的字段2,C表的字段3到表4中去。不需要表中的数据。
用SQL语句应如何实现呢?
这里需要考虑一个问题,所到的指定表是不是空表?所以,我们有以下两种情况分别说说: /*table4不存在时*/
select a.col1, b.col2, c.col3
into table4
from tableA a, tableB b, tableC c
...
- 2009-09-10 19:58
- 浏览 2676
- 评论(0)
可选用的数据集主要包括Cora、Citeseer、DBLP三类。
DBLP数据集用XML描述,字段信息包括:author、title、pages、year、booktitle、url、crossref、publisher、ee、cdrom、isbn、cite_label等。其中作者名属性信息的格式是统一的,处理比较方便。目前,DBLP对作者重名问题的处理已经有不错的效果。例如:输入一作者名“wei wang”,可以得到16个不同的作者及其工作单位,并能链接得到每个作者的发表论文情况、个人主页和合作者列表等信息。(不存在问题了吗?)此外,引文信息中除了基本信息:作者名、文章名、会议名之外,加入新 ...
- 2009-09-08 11:30
- 浏览 3155
- 评论(0)
彦姐姐最近遇到点麻烦,代码总是调不出来,老师压迫的还挺紧,没想到我今天竟给了她点启发,嘿,出结果了,这兴奋的呦,据说是有种醍醐灌顶的感觉,顺带着也表扬了下我最近的学习成果,挺美~呵呵
彦妮儿总是喜欢思考人生,却也容易把自己绕进死胡同,有点类似走火入魔,需要时不时地看看《遇见未知的自己》这类似九阳真经的书籍来疏通脉络。我们总是太理想化,渴望美好的生活,渴望浪漫的爱情,却也在渴望中越发的看到现实的残酷。当理想照进现实,我们不可避免的遇到种种问题。然后恍然,一夜长大。
这一年,大家的变化还都挺大的。阿英和小卓合伙鄙视我和彦姐姐,因为我们还有寒暑假,殊不知我们的处境,这种心理就有点类似《围城》中所说 ...
- 2009-09-08 11:28
- 浏览 721
- 评论(0)
Dijkstra算法用于解决单源最短路径问题,用到贪心算法。常用于稠密图,不能用于负权边。用于稀疏图时,可考虑使用优先队列(二叉堆或斐波那契堆)。
Prim和Kruskal算法用于最小生成树。
Prim算法的执行非常类似于寻找图的最短通路的Dijkstra算法。Prim算法的特点是集合A中的边总是只形成单棵树。如图5所示,阴影覆盖的边属于正在生成的树,树中的结点为黑色。在算法的每一步,树中的结点确定了图的一个割,并且通过该割的轻边被加进树中。树从任意根结点r开始形成并逐渐生长直至该树跨越了V中的所有结点。在每一步,连接A中某结点到V-A中某结点的轻边被加入到树中,由推论2,该规则仅加大对A安 ...
- 2009-09-05 08:42
- 浏览 2694
- 评论(0)
结论:
排序方法 平均时间 最坏时间 辅助存储
简单排序 O(n2) O(n2) O(1)
快速排序 O(nlogn) O(n2) O(logn)
堆排序 O(nlogn) O(nlogn) O(1)
归并排序 O(nlogn) O(nlogn) O(n)
基数排序 O(d(n+rd)) O(d(n+rd)) O(rd)
另外:直接 ...
- 2009-08-31 11:12
- 浏览 1501
- 评论(0)
转自:http://blog.sina.com.cn/s/blog_4997a23a0100b2xc.html
分作互联网、软件、硬件、网络4个方向,这样大家也好对比一下。
互联网:
百度: 搜索等核心部门16W+,实习是一个很好的途径,我有几个同学都是实习时留下的
google: 18W+ ...
- 2009-08-31 08:06
- 浏览 8476
- 评论(0)
一般用于数据库的索引,综合效率较高。
这两种处理索引的数据结构的不同之处:
1。B树中同一键值不会出现多次,并且它有可能出现在叶结点,也有可能出现在非叶结点中。而B+树的键一定会出现在叶结点中,并且有可能在非叶结点中也有可能重复出现,以维持B+树的平衡。
2。因为B树键位置不定,且在整个树结构中只出现一次,虽然可以节省存储空间,但使得在插入、删除操作复杂度明显增加。B+树相比来说是一种较好的折中。
3。B树的查询效率与键在树中的位置有关,最大时间复杂度与B+树相同(在叶结点的时候),最小时间复杂度为1(在根结点的时候)。而B+树的时候复杂度对某建成的树是固定的。
- 2009-08-25 20:14
- 浏览 2804
- 评论(0)
1、父子二人看到一辆十分豪华的进口轿车。儿子不屑地对他的父亲说:“坐这种车的人,肚子里一定没有学问!”父亲则轻描淡写地回答:“说这种话的人,口袋里一定没有钱!”
——你对事情的看法,是不是也反映出你内心真正的态度?
2、晚饭后,母亲和女儿一块儿洗碗盘,父亲和儿子在客厅看电视。突然,厨房里传来打破盘子的响声,然后一片沉寂。儿子望着他父亲,说道:“一定是妈妈打破的。”“你怎么知道?”“她没有骂人。”
——我们习惯以不同的标准来看人看己,以致往往是责人以严,待己以宽。
3、有两个台湾观光团到**伊豆半岛旅游,路况很坏,到处都是坑洞。一位导游连声说路面简直像麻子一样。而另一个导游却诗意盎 ...
- 2009-08-21 10:25
- 浏览 773
- 评论(0)
本文主要包括二个部分,第一部分重点介绍在VC中,怎么样采用sizeof来求结构的大小,以及容易出现的问题,并给出解决问题的方法,第二部分总结出VC中sizeof的主要用法。
1、 sizeof应用在结构上的情况
请看下面的结构:
struct ...
- 2009-08-20 21:24
- 浏览 1229
- 评论(0)
摘 要:本文展示了Http协议的强大能力,如何定义什么是Restful Web Service架构以及以当今RPC式Web服务的对比,并解析了Restful Web Service架构的四个特征:可寻址性、无状态性、连通性和统一接口。
关键字:HTTP;URL;REST;Web服务
中图分类号:TP393.04 文献标识码:A
Analysis of Restful Web Service Architecture
ZHAO Bo-wen
(School of Software Engineering, Tongji Universit ...
- 2009-07-29 14:55
- 浏览 2253
- 评论(1)
本文来自CSDN博客,转载请标明出处:http://blog.csdn.net/ztz0223/archive/2008/12/24/3599016.aspx
很早想说说这个问题了,经常也会有很多公司拿位域出来考人,呵呵要真的想弄清楚还要一点点的分析。
这里先看看网宿的一道笔试题目,这道题目我之前是复制网上的,结果不对,修改了一下,可以正确运行了,谢谢(imafish_i )提醒:
//假设硬件平台是intel x86(little endian)
typedef unsigned int uint32_t;
void inet_ntoa(uint32_t in)
{
...
- 2009-07-22 15:16
- 浏览 1247
- 评论(0)
#include <stdio.h>
#include <stdlib.h>
#include <assert.h>
#include <string.h>
#define CL_SUCCESS 0
#define CL_NO_MEM 1
#define CL_EMPTY 2
#define CL_ZERO_SIZE 3
typedef struct CL_ITEM{
int Tag;
struct CL_ITEM *Prev, *Next;
void *Object;
size_t Size;
}CL_ITE ...
- 2009-07-17 22:11
- 浏览 1852
- 评论(0)
typedef int ElementType;
/*List.h*/
#ifndef _List_H
#define _List_H
struct Node;
typedef struct Node *PtrToNode;
typedef PtrToNode List;
typedef PtrToNode Position;
List MakeEmpty( List L );
int IsEmpty( List L );
int ...
- 2009-07-17 08:37
- 浏览 1108
- 评论(0)